Laid Off to Agency Owner: Zach Keen’s Proven Blueprint for Launching and Growing a Winning Recruiting Firm

Zach Keen, the founder of Keen Search and Staffing, shares his transformative journey from being laid off to successfully running a recruiting firm. He discusses the importance of mentorship and securing investors to ease the transition. Zach offers insights into modern business development strategies, contrasting traditional approaches with innovative outreach. He candidly addresses the challenges of balancing family life with entrepreneurship while emphasizing the need for authenticity in client relationships. Zero to Booked: How Andy Roads Started His Own Firm and Landed Clients Instantly (No Bullshit)

Have you ever asked yourself what it really takes to break away from a decade-long career at a recruiting firm, step out on your own, and land new clients right from the start—even when the salary, security, and a promised succession plan suddenly disappear?   If you're a recruiter frustrated by stagnant growth, office politics, or waiting for a buy-in that's always just out of reach, this episode goes straight to the heart of your dilemma. In today’s competitive recruiting world, waiting for permission often means missing out. Benjamin Mena sits down with Andy, who shares his raw, behind-the-scenes journey from loyal employee to founder of High Altitude Recruiting. You’ll hear firsthand how Andy turned uncertainty, fear, and even a restrictive non-compete into rocket fuel for launching his own agency and booking clients within days—without gimmicks or empty buzzwords. If you want to break free, earn what you’re worth, and thrive in 2024’s market, this episode is packed with actionable insights tailored just for you. Learn how to unlock the power of your professional network: Andy details the exact approach and messaging that drove a 60% response rate and immediate client interest through personalized LinkedIn outreach—even connecting with founders, HR leaders, and industry decision-makers with a modest yet irresistible offer.See why mastering both mindset and operational basics matters: Discover Andy’s step-by-step method for setting up a nimble recruiting business (think: ATS selection, on-site client meetings, transparent service, and value-driven pricing inspired by industry leaders like Alex Hormozi).Find out how to shift from reactive to proactive business development: Whether you’re considering starting your own agency or want to bring in more clients now, Andy and Ben reveal real-world tactics—from referrals and industry events, to content and branding—that build credibility, foster referrals, and keep your pipeline full even through market slowdowns.
